They Say All Media Guide

Having helped establish Ollie Jacobs’ Memphis Industries imprint as a purveyor of outstanding cinematica, Andy Dragazis followed his widely licensed Nothing Changes Under the Sun debut with a second long-player effort for none other than XL. The resultant 12 tracks are nothing short of astonishing, with Ty Bulmer adding a final vocal flourish to some magnificent music. Lazy labeling is best left alone, as Dragazis has succeeded in creating something of his own, as far from the widely prescribed but hard to pin down “chill-out” tag as it could be, a place where studio-tech trickery and earthly instrumentation collide with what is best described as cinematic majesty. – Kingsley Marshall
